The retention sweeper deletes records past their configured retention window, running hourly against the archive store. Because deletions are irreversible, any change to sweep rules, retention periods, or the dry-run safeguard requires explicit approval before deployment. On-call engineers: if the sweeper pages you, pause it via the kill switch first and investigate second — never widen a retention rule to silence an alert. Emergency overrides must be logged and approved within 24 hours. All approvals go through the single accountable owner.

named custodian: Brivan Eliath Quenox Frador

Runbook: Scanline barcode bridge

If warehouse scans stop flowing into Cartwheel, it's almost always the bridge service on the Dunmore floor box wedging after a USB hiccup. Bounce the service first — nine times out of ten that fixes it. If not, check the queue depth before escalating. When restarting, make sure the bridge comes up with these settings.

deployment values, yafop-bajef:
[gilok]
team = ulaius
access_code = ac_423664
host = gilok.sivrelhq.corp
port = 9200
owner = pelius.istax
peer = eliok.torvasoft.internal

## Onboarding: Incremental Rebuilds (Slatepress)

Slatepress rebuilds only pages whose content hashes changed. The dependency graph lives in the build manifest; touching a shared layout invalidates all descendants. Review checklist: confirm hash inputs include frontmatter, verify cache-bust on template edits, reject PRs that force full rebuilds without justification. CI triggers rebuilds via the internal build orchestrator. Local testing against the orchestrator requires the key below.

API key for tagug-tajef: vxb4-R1fo

TICKET PAY-4412: Duplicate charges on retry despite idempotency keys

PaySprocket retry worker regenerates the idempotency key on each attempt. Should reuse original.

Repro:
1. POST a charge to staging gateway, force a 503.
2. Observe worker retry after 30s.
3. Check logs: new key generated, charge duplicated.

Expected: same key across retries. Use the staging token below to reproduce.

session JWT of yawep-yawep = eyJhbGciOiJIUzI1NiIsInR5cCI6IkpXVCJ9.eyJzdWIiOiI3pWF3_In0.aXYsHiog